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C problems call for emergency service. Recognizing these concerns can assist you know when to call for professional help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working entirely, specifically throughout extreme weather condition, it's more than simply an inconvenience-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C specialists can diagnose and fix the issue without delay, restoring your home's convenience and security.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Strange sounds like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system typically indicate a major mechanical issue that might lead to bigger concerns if not attended to quickly. Similarly, unusual smells might show electrical problems or even gas leaks. Our expert HVAC specialists can recognize these problems and make necessary repairs before they end up being unsafe.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can damage your home and lead to mold growth. Our professionals locate the source of leakages and repair them properly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ks reduce your air conditioner's cooling capability and can damage the environment. They need expert attention as refrigerant handling calls for spec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ical elements in your HVAC system position fire hazards and need to be attended to instantly by qualified professionals. Our HVAC contractors have the training to securely repair electrical problems.

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work harder and minimizes comfort. Our HVAC professionals identify airflow problems, whether brought on by duct issues, dirty filters, or fan issues.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ation concerns, or an poorly sized system. Our expert HVAC professionals can diagnose these problems and suggest services.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off regularly, it wastes energy and breaks parts quicker. Our HVAC professionals can figure out whether the problem stems from a clogged fil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den increases in energy expenses often show HVAC ineffectiveness. Our contractors carry out energy efficiency evaluations to identify the cause and recommend impro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ems should help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summertime or too dry in winter season, our HVAC contractors can recommend services to improve conv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what looks like a system failure is actually a thermostat problem. Our HVAC contractors can repair or replace th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or clever designs for better comfort control and energy savings.
